#a5e375 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a5e375 is composed of 64.7% red, 89%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.5%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 93.8 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 67.5%. #a5e375 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ffea with #4bc700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#a5e375 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a5e375 has RGB values of R:165, G:227,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:0.48,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 10871669.

Shades and Tints of #a5e375

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050902 is the darkest color, while #fafdf7 is the lightest one.
